In another classic Jundo talk, he takes away all the mystery, high hopes and leaves us pretty disappointed in zen’s ability to fix any of the ills in our life. Or even to at least make us feel great while we are sitting for the day.
Jundo even points out that “counter-intuitive as it may seem, a Sangha or Teacher which meets all the student's expectations, golden dreams, ideals and desires too would be a disservice”
So not only do we not get peaches and cream, but we should be prepared for rough spots.
